The GPS simulator can simulate GPS positioning navigation and precise timing signal, which can be applied to R & D, generation and measurement of navigation and reception. The GPS simulator can real-time test the positioning, timing, sensitivity and motion trajectory of ship borne receiver or vehicle receiver.
The SYN5203 GPS simulator can complete ranging accuracy test, navigation message test, lock out re capture test, positioning accuracy test, speed accuracy test, channel delay test, conformance test, bit error rate test and so on, which will greatly enhance the work efficiency.

The GPS simulator is also suitable for the development and testing of location guided time service products, which can greatly improve efficiency and avoid frequent field testing, thus greatly improving the speed of product development and testing deployment.
The SYN5203 satellite signal simulator can theoretically connect all the GPS receivers within the range of 10 thousand square meters and 100 meters in radius. If it is necessary to reduce the analog GPS signal strength and prevent the signal from overly affecting other devices, it is recommended that the device and simulator be connected directly, and the signal after direct connection is weak. Additionally, the signal attenuator can be added to the output interface of the simulator.
With regard to the track length of the SYN5203 satellite simulator, the default standard version is 32G support for 100 minutes and 64g support for 200 minutes, and so on. Users can purchase larger SD cards themselves or extend to 1T external hard disks. It can preset multiple trajectories or static trajectories, that is, fixed points. The track switch is convenient, and the track preset number is not limited, and the detailed data such as velocity and acceleration can be set.It has the functions of single run and infinite loop.
The device supports ephemeris input. In practical applications, the receiver of the client is unable to distinguish the signals and real signals provided by the GPS simulator, because all statements received by the receiver can be output. But the equipment is limited to scientific research, technology exchange and equipment maintenance.
There are 4 main functions: static (fixed point) trajectory making, dynamic trajectory making, track signal sending and real-time track recording. In real time, track record is recorded in the place where the simulated trajectory is needed. It can also be understood as the recording and playback process.
